A body-positive wellness lifestyle is built on the philosophy that all bodies deserve respect and care, regardless of how they compare to societal beauty standards. Unlike traditional wellness models that often focus on weight loss, this approach prioritizes , viewing health as a holistic balance of mental, physical, and emotional well-being. 1. The global naturist movement has a rich history documented through literature, photography, and independent films. Historical archives and documentaries typically focus on the cultural, health, and social aspects of the lifestyle. From early 20th-century movements to modern explorations of eco-living, authentic media serves to educate the public and demystify the practice.
